Eligibility Criteria

  • Must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ized board with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ology or Mathematics as core subjects along with English.
  • Must have secured a minimum 50% aggregate marks in PCB/PCM for General/OBC/EWS category (45% for SC/ST/PwD).
  • Must have completed at least 17 years of age on or before December 31 of the year of admission.
  • Must be a citizen of India.
  • Admission is based on merit in Class 12 scores or UPSEE (AKTU entrance exam). NEET UG is not required for B.Pharm.

Admission Process

Admission to B.Pharm at Kalka Pharmacy Institute for Advanced Studies is merit-based on Class 12 PCB/PCM scores or UPSEE (Dr. A.P.J. Abdul Kalam Technical University entrance exam) scores. Candidates apply through the KGI admissions portal or AKTU UPSEE counselling portal. The college is affiliated to Dr. A.P.J. Abdul Kalam Technical University (AKTU), Lucknow, and is approved by the Pharmacy Council of India (PCI). After application, a merit list is published and shortlisted candidates must report for document verification and fee payment to confirm admission. B.Pharm covers pharmaceutical sciences, drug formulation, pharmacology, pharmacognosy, pharmaceutical chemistry, and pharmacy practice. NEET UG is not required for this program. Hostel facility is available at Rs. 95,000 per year.

Detailed Fee Structure

Rs. 92,500 / Year | Total tuition fee for 4-year course: Rs. 3,70,000 | Hostel Fee: Rs. 95,000 / Year | Grand Total including hostel: Rs. 7,50,000 approx. for entire 4-year course.
